As a powerstroke enthusiast, hell I like anything diesel just about but my heart lays with ford, I can tell you that the 6.0s can actually be reliable engines. Sure the 7.3 was a hell of an engine and the new 6.4 can easily handle 800 horsepower with out upgrading a damn thing, even the transmission can survive but the 6.0s arent that bad. First off, they are reliable until you add any sort of power to them, they seem to like to blow head gaskets with any power increase. So if you plan on adding power you better be going with some ARP headstuds along with it. Also I recomment upgrading to a better aftermarket egr valve, those go out to. With those simple fixes you got a hell of an engine. Now to see how this 6.7 holds up. Its suppose to be better than the 6.4( I will wait and see if thats true) and get better MPG( something the 6.4 isnt good at) only time will tell.
